What is LASIK Surgery?
LASIK stands for Laser-Assisted In Situ Keratomileusis, in other words, LASIK is a kind of refractive surgery in which the eye treatment includes cutting of corneal tissue by the means of laser so as to adjust and improve the eye vision problems such as myopia, astigmatism, and hypermetropia.
According to the process, the cornea, also known as the clear front covering of the eye, is reformed, so the point where the light enters the eye is the retina, therefore, leading to more precise and clearer vision.

How LASIK Surgery Works – Step-by-Step
Getting to know the procedure makes it easier for you to be at peace with what happens next. I’ll take you through what will probably take place if you undergo LASIK surgery in India:
Eye Examination:
First things first – your vision and cornea are carefully screened. This process involves, among others, determining how thick your cornea is, how large your pupils are, and getting a printout of your corneal topography with the use of a sophisticated computerized instrument.
Anesthesia:
The first step is to apply eye drops carrying the anesthetic effect for the eyes to be pain-free.
Flap Creation:
The specialized instrument cuts a little cover off the cornea with the help of a laser or a microkeratome.
Reshaping the Cornea:
The laser is used to remove the cornea to give it a new shape so as to fulfill your sight requirements.
Repositioning the Flap:
The cover is gently put back in its original place, where it sticks and heals in two days without a need for any stitches to be put in.
Post-Operative Care:
After the operation, the surgeon gives you a bottle of eye drops and a set of instructions for caring. On this very day, you are allowed to return home.

Who is an Ideal Candidate for LASIK?
There is no one-fits-all answer for the best person for LASIK surgery in India. Visiting an Eye Specialist in Panipat will help you get a qualified and ready answer, but there are basic requirements for everyone:
✅ At least 18 years old
✅ Vision is not changing unlike the past year
✅ Normal corneas
✅ Rarely having any or no severe dry eyes or corneal diseases
✅ No present eye infections
People with thin corneas or certain medical conditions may not be eligible and might need alternative procedures such as PRK or SMILE laser.
Possible Risks and Side Effects
While LASIK is thought to be very safe, one should still be capable of understanding their potential risks so as to set high-quality expectations.
Common Temporary Side Effects:
- You may experience dry eyes for a few weeks
- Glare or halos may appear at night
- Mild discomfort or watery eyes may be present
- Sensitivity to light may occur
Most of the side effects will get better within a few weeks as the eyes get healed. Recovery and Aftercare Tips
Recovery after LASIK Surgery in India is short but very important. Following your doctor’s instructions and recommendations is critical for the best outcome.
Post-Surgery Care Tips:
- Don’t Rub Your Eyes: The corneal flap may get displaced.
- Use the Eye Drops that Your Doctor Prescribes: This is the only way to prevent dry eyes.
- Put on the Goggles or Safety Glasses: Especially for those who spend a lot of time outside during the day, in order to avoid dust and light.
- Stay Away from Swimming and Makeup: At least until one week post-op.
- Preventive measures and regular monitoring: Don’t miss the regular check-ups with your Eye Specialist in Panipat as they will also get to assess the progress.
In addition, most people can cut back on their work within a day in order to get back to their daily routine by the end of the third day. It is only a few weeks that the eyes will take to stop changing and stabilizing in terms of vision.

How to Prepare for LASIK Surgery
In order to have a smooth experience, do the following before the day of your surgery appointment:
- Do not wear contact lenses for at least one week before the evaluation.
- Do not use eye makeup on the day of the surgery.
- Have a light meal before the surgery.
- Have someone ready to drive you home.

1. Is LASIK surgery painful?
No, LASIK is painless. Numbing eye drops are used to ensure complete comfort.
2. How much time is typically required for the LASIK operation?
The procedure time for both eyes is generally around 10–15 minutes.
3. What is the earliest time I can go back to my job after LASIK?
Two to three days after the surgery, most people work again.
4. How long do LASIK effects last?
Vision enhancement is permanent, but the development of the eye may change and cause vision problems later.
5. Is laser eye surgery possible if I have dry eyes?
Basic measures can be taken to address mild dry eyes before the surgery. Severe dry eyes, however, may prevent one from undergoing the procedure.
6. Can you suggest LASIK alternatives?
PRK and SMILE are just two of the options available for those who don’t qualify for LASIK.
7. Is LASIK insurance-covered?
Generally not, since it’s considered a voluntary procedure. Nevertheless, a few policies might have a partial payment benefit.
